6+ Blocked: Messenger Sent vs Delivered [2024]

The status of messages dispatched via Facebook Messenger to a recipient who has restricted communication differs depending on whether the sender observes a “sent” or “delivered” indication. A “sent” status typically signifies that the message has left the sender’s device and reached Facebook’s servers. Conversely, a “delivered” status confirms that the message has successfully reached the recipient’s device, though not necessarily that it has been viewed. In instances where a user has blocked another, this latter status is often absent.

Understanding these delivery indicators is crucial for interpreting communication success and managing expectations. The absence of a “delivered” confirmation can signal a disruption in connectivity, technical issues, or, significantly, restrictions imposed by the recipient. Historically, these indicators have evolved to provide senders with better insights into message progression, but their reliability is contingent upon network conditions and user privacy settings.

8+ Facebook: Following vs. Friends & Followers?

Facebook offers two distinct mechanisms for connecting with other users: a system where a mutual agreement is required for connection, and an alternative where one user subscribes to another’s public updates without requiring reciprocal approval. The former creates a two-way link allowing both parties to view each other’s content (subject to privacy settings), akin to a traditional acquaintance. The latter establishes a one-way subscription where one user receives the public updates of another without the other necessarily following back. An example would be a user interested in a public figure’s posts; they can subscribe to these updates without the public figure initiating a connection.

Understanding the difference is crucial for effective platform utilization. For personal connections, the two-way system is typically employed, maintaining privacy and control over shared content. The one-way subscription model, however, facilitates access to public information and updates from individuals or organizations with a broad audience. This distinction has evolved alongside the platform, reflecting shifts in user behavior and the increasing need for both intimate social networking and access to public information.

9+ Ways: Is Someone Stalking You on Facebook? Tips

Determining if an individual is excessively monitoring one’s Facebook profile involves assessing various platform features and observed behaviors. While Facebook does not explicitly provide a stalker detection tool, certain patterns and account activities can suggest heightened interest or obsessive viewing. Observing consistent likes, comments, or shares across numerous posts, especially on older content, might indicate prolonged scrutiny. Analyzing the People You May Know section for consistently suggested profiles connected to a specific individual can also offer insights, as can noticing unusual friend request patterns.

Understanding potential indicators of excessive online attention is important for maintaining personal privacy and security on social media platforms. Recognizing these signs allows users to proactively manage their digital footprint, adjust privacy settings to restrict access to profile information, and take appropriate action if they feel threatened or harassed. The ability to control who can view content and engage with a profile empowers users to foster a safer online environment.
